#e345e3 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e345e3 is composed of 89% red, 27.1% green and 89%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 69.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 300 degrees, a saturation of 73.8% and a lightness of 58%. #e345e3 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8aff with #c700c7.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.

#e345e3 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e345e3 has RGB values of R:227, G:69, B:227 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.7, Y:0,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14894563.
